sending save the date

jadewills13, 10 February, 2012 at 10:59 Posted on Planning 0 4

Hi im not getting married till 2015 when do i send save the dates im just getting excited we gonna start making them ourselfs soon x

    Hmm, usually I'd say send them as early as you want, but 3 years is probably too early. I think 18 months would be the earliest, and even then I'm waiting to the 1 year mark to send mine. I know it's exciting, but hold off a bit!

    Im sending mine out upto 18 months ahead, maybe a little less. Then invites about 8 months ahead due to it being bank hol.

    3 years is a little to far in advance, 99% of people will lose them and no one will have a diary to write the date in so they won't even beable to save the date! im not sending mine till 11-12 months before, its killing me holding off sending them but as its sept next year no one really cares yet!

    We sent ours about 15 months in advance because people just kept on asking us, plus it will be in peak holiday time. In the end it didn't matter because only a very few family members have kept hold of them and even OH's sisters forgot our date and nearly a booked a holiday! So in the end they have been fairly useless in our case.

    I haven't bothered with them- just emailed or told people by word of mouth, we have let people know our date- so was probs about 19 months in advance because it is a friday in the middle of August when people might be booking holidays, and because some people will have to take time off work.
